Resourceurl in liferay download

In this article will be show how to develop a file upload and download portlet using spring mvc portlet. Dr how can i download a file from my server using java portlet resourcerequest. We will be using action url for file upload and resource url for file download. Liferay blob data concept in portlet posted on september 30, 2014 by hamidul islam in liferay. This page generates a html fragment and includes resourceurl tags.

How to pass data from page to portlet class through ajax call. We have a form where we create users in liferay and it should go through approval processie. A goodlooking site has to have a wellformatted user interface ui for its portlets. Liferay portal community edition license this library, liferay portal community edition, is free software licensed software. A blob alternately known as a binary large object, basic large object, blob, or blob is a collection of binary data stored as a single entity in a database management system. How to obtain the download url for a document library content programmatically. Findnerds php questions and answers forum is developed for those tech geeks who dont want to wait for a longer duration of time, as the community members within findnerd can answer any android query within shortest possible time frame. A blog which offer posts over liferay, ui, tools and many more. In serveresource method, use portletrequestdispatcher to include a jsp page as return liferay 5. October 19, 2015 sachin156 download file from portlet, download file in liferay, liferay 6. Liferay portal is produced by the worldwide liferay engineering team, and involves many hours of development, testing, writing documentation, and working with the wider liferay community of customers, partners, and open source developers. Code you need the best deals on the most popular software. To work with reports ee portlet we should have jrxml and need to upload in to the definition to generate csv and pdf formats or any other formats. Contribute to liferayliferayportal development by creating an account on github.

Lets bind the view and controller code into a portlet, i have created a portlet with a portlet controller class and two jsps, view. Change required namespace parameter in your liferayportlet. The liferay faces bridge component suite provides many portlet 2. Can we take advantage of this framework in liferay portlet development. This tag is used to create resource url in portlet jsp in this article, i will be showing you how to create resource url by portlet tag. This is an invaluable source of trouble shooting, code samples, tutorials, and addons, all of which are readily available. Fields to by synced are flagged using a a custom attribute datamodelinput. Liferay used nodejs theme generator to create, build and deploy the themes. It is used to build single page application spa projects. Select mysql from jdbc template and modify database name if it is different from lportal and click on next.

Liferay setup and simple portlet tutorial,liferay tutorial. Mainly focused on enterprise portal technology, the company has its headquarters in diamond bar, california, united states history. Getting started with liferay once your download completes, follow our quick start guide to get up and running quickly, and watch this introductory video to learn your way around. How to install lifeary theme from browser liferay themes. Download a file to browser with liferay serveresource. Its a blog about liferay development, administration, devops, ui technologies and many more. After the video, be sure to check out the resources below to discover more about liferay s features and how you can make the most of your investment. This jar file contains classes and interfaces under javax. I recommend to use liferays with alloyui instead of using simple xml function. Each resource url has a specific cache level assigned with it. As liferay portal is open source, it has a large community of developers.

How to autosave form and rich text editor content in liferay. In this article, i will be showing you how to create resource url by portlet tag. By default liferay for windows includes the java 1. After that you need to followup liferay documanets to learn. This page generates a html fragment and includes tags. Download liferay7 plugins sdk and extract into local file system. May 20, 2012 this entry was posted on may 20, 2012, in code snippets, developement, liferay, portal, spring mvc portlet and tagged file download, file upload, liferay, resource url, spring mvc, spring mvc portlet, spring mvc portlet file upload. Sun provides implementation of portlet api which resides in portlet. Sep 30, 2014 liferay blob data concept in portlet posted on september 30, 2014 by hamidul islam in liferay. A portlet, as the name suggests, is a part of a portal.

If you will be using liferay portal ce in a standalone environment, we recommend downloading the tomcat bundle. For example, if you wish to call resource url of other portlet which is placed on different liferay page then you can use this tag. This tag is used to create resource url in portlet jsp. Currently covers inputs of type hidden, text, textarea, checkbox and radio. From your js code, replace the content of a div by the returned fragment 4. Build your project on the community supported liferay portal ce which is designed for smaller, noncritical deployments and contributing to liferay development. In the downloads section, select windows 64 bit bundle and click on download. From render response and portlet tag library we can create url for only current portlet from portleturlfactoryutil class and liferayportlet tag library we can create urls to other portlets means from one portlet to other portlet we can create. Before seeing how to use ajax in liferay portlet, you need to understand portlet namespace. Download latest dxp server from liferay customer portal, using the credentials provided by liferay as part of licensing agreement. In case if you wish to point different portlet which is placed on some different liferay page, you need to create resource url by liferay portlet.

Liferay 7 plugin sdk tutorial java,liferay, liferay 7. Liferay portal is originally based upon the j2ee platform and is available on all leading application servers. There are several different manufacturers of karaoke computer software so you should be able to find computer software that is compatible with your operating system. When using liferay s mvc framework, you can create resource urls in your jsps to retrieve images, xml, or any other kind of resource from a liferay instance. After the video, be sure to check out the resources below to discover more about liferays features and how you can make the most of your investment.

Create a folder on your machine where you want to setup your liferay environment. This level can be either full, portlet or page and denotes the cacheability of the resource in the browser the default cache level of a resource url. For projects that support packagereference, copy this xml node into the project file to reference the package. Liferay 7 plugin sdk tutorial,liferay 7 plugin sdk portlet.

Ajax in liferay portlet using jquery and alloyui roufid. The making of a portlet is similar to the process of writing a servlet. To learn liferay, you must have knowledge of java j2ee. Bitnami certified images are always uptodate, secure, and built to work right out of the box. Download liferay dxps war file and dependencies from the customer portal. Hello guys below code will help you to download file from server using liferay 6. Liferay portal is the worlds leading enterprise open source portal framework, offering integrated web publishing and content management, an enterprise service bus and serviceoriented architecture, and compatibility with all major it infrastructure. Some time we need to uploadby file some data and process them. Download file after successful form submit actionurl. Namespacing avoids portlet element to conflict with other portlet elements having the same name.

This level can be either full, portlet or page and denotes the cacheability of the resource in the browser. Liferay with spring make us better way of using spring capabilities and liferay capabilities. Finally you got home screen now add mysql java connection in liferaydeveloperstudio\liferayportal6. Spring portlet development, we can use all liferay apis so that we can develop portlets very easy and if the developers have best understanding about spring then its good choice to develop spring portlets in liferay. For downloading documents liferay supports jasper reports engine and one of the market place ee portlet like reports portlet is also works on the same. The resource url then invokes the corresponding mvc resource command class mvcresourcecommand that processes the resource request and response. For better understanding create portlet in your eclipse and follow below steps. I recommend to use liferay s resourceurl var resourceurl resourceurl with alloyui instead of using simple xml function. It uses clientside data binding to build dynamic views of data that change immediately in response to user actions. Liferays original product, liferay portal, was created in 2000 by chief software architect brian chan to provide an enterprise.

The resourceurl defines a resource url that when clicked will result in a serveresource call of the resourceservingportlet interface each resource url has a specific cache level assigned with it. What are the fundamentals that every liferay developer s. If the omni admin fills that form then the user must not go through approval process and when the same form is accessed by any other user it must go through. Liferay is a portal, web content management, and collaboration suite.

We can create liferay urls in different ways from tag library java classes and java script. The resourceurl defines a resource url that when clicked will result in a serveresource call of the resourceservingportlet interface. Liferay faces is an open source umbrella project that provides support for the javaserver faces jsf standard in webapp and portlet projects. Karaoke computer software will allow you to burn, play, and create karaoke songs on your computer. Spring mvc portlet file upload and download portal hub. A recent study proved that the average man lasts just 25 minutes in bed during intercourse. Action and resource friendly url parameters work correctly. Portlet namespace is a unique value generated and associated to each portlet by the portal.

Working with liferay urls in liferay development we have many options to create liferay urls i. The main difference is, resource url created by portlet. Also saves the content of spans with the attribute datamodelinput. After upload theme will hot deploy, you can view in tomcat as below. It features tools such as a document library, offline document sync, internal messaging, online interface, and more. Introduction to portlets using liferay portal part 2. The study also showed that many women need at least 710 minutes of intercourse to reach the big o and, worse still.

Change required namespace parameter in your liferay portlet. I am building what is essentially a browser for our cms with a liferay 6. Action url render url and resource url in liferay 7 dxp. If you looking for creating a simple hello world article please check this article. Spa using angularjs in liferay portlet blogs surekha. How to autosave form and rich text editor content in.

1274 1232 778 479 86 1549 514 530 647 289 1363 53 969 761 455 1585 867 228 1377 1365 97 777 127 1415 1361 1131 1495 328 1232 82 500 919 882 1295 1352 1481 1441 1077 264 212 1326 683 1285